57 Manchester United fans arrested in Bruges, Belgian police report
Fifty-seven Manchester United fans were arrested in Bruges on Wednesday night as fighting took the gloss off their emphatic Champions League win over Club Brugge.
Chief Constable of Bruges Police Dirk van Nuffel said glasses and chairs were thrown in a clash between English and Belgian “hooligans” outside a bar in the city centre after the 4-0 win, which put United into the Champions League group stages.
